  • What are Uninettuno Massive Open Online Courses (MOOC)
    mooc-close

    Thanks to the UNINETTUNO MOOCs you will be able to freely follow the lectures of the best Italian and international lecturers drawn from a selection of the best courses of UNINETTUNO, in Italian, English and Arabic; you will have at your disposal digitised and indexed on-demand video lectures, usable on a PC as well as on smart phone and tablet, including hypertextual links to more-in-depth study materials (books and articles, practice work, slides, bibliographical references, lists of websites). You will also have at your disposal a collaborative discussion environment, a thematic forum by means of which you will be able to exchange views with your colleagues on the issues dealt with in the lectures, discuss the practice work done, cooperatively create new knowledge in a process that will see you active players of your own learning process.

Cultural Heritage Operator (Academic Year 2009/2010)

Cultural anthropology


Credits: 6
Available languages: IT
Content language:Italian
Course description
In the 18 video lectures the course os focused on the epistemological and methodological bases of the discipline, as well as on its applicative features. A soecific attention is paid on the theme of cultural heritage.
Prerequisites
Una buona conoscenza “geografica” delle diverse realtà economiche, sociali e culturali del mondo.
Objectives
- provide a general view on the articulation of current Cultural Anthropology. - Provide tools for the knowledge of the various theoretical and methodological efforts undertaken by the discipline in order to comprehend the different cultures in the world - Analyze of cultural, political and social processes at the base of migration, conflicts and diasporas in an increasing complex world. - Analyze the interpretative models to grasp the complexity characterizing our societies.
Program
1) Origins and key concepts 2) Anthropology of the Contemporary 3) Anthropology, Arts and Cultural Heritage
